Mac OS X - full-screen video makes entire screen go black
ISSUE
When I click the full-screen button on any video in the Steam.app Mac client, the entire screen goes black and the only way to get control of my computer back is to hit CMD-OPT-ESC which then immediately crashes the Steam app.

OS
Mac OS X 10.11.6
iMac 27-inch, Late 2013, with external monitor


This is a *regression* -- for a long time you couldn't play videos on Mac, then you fixed it about a year ago, now it's back.

When I try to make a video from the steam client app go to full screen by hitting the rectangle in the bottom right hand side of the video window, the audio continues to play but the screen goes black. If I hit the escape key, the steam client screen becomes visible again with the non-full-screen video playing as an embedded element of the page. If I right-click on the video and select "Copy Page URL" and paste it into the Safari browser, it brings up the page with the embedded video on it. If I play the video in Safari, I can make it full screen as expected. I am having this problem on a 2021MacBook Pro running macOS Ventura 13.0.1.
